Output 68e44d065ebd005c888ef380111f864efe38d021e49b88f9f9253cffe2c9bb32:14

value
3111217
script pubkey
OP_0 OP_PUSHBYTES_20 8869e51291cb149d7494a1458bc26a19e26053e2
address
bc1q3p572y53ev2f6ay559zchsn2r83xq5lztprwu4
transaction
68e44d065ebd005c888ef380111f864efe38d021e49b88f9f9253cffe2c9bb32